7. Features
PCI 762 – User’s Guide (Version 1.0)
7.
Features
CPU
Intel® Core™ i3 Desktop Processor
Intel® Core™ i5 Desktop Processor
Intel® Core™ i7 Desktop Processor
System Chipset
Intel
®
Q77
CPU Socket
LGA1155 Socket
DRAM Transfer Rate
1066/1600 MHz
BIOS
AMI BIOS via SPI interface with socket
System Memory
Two 240-pin DDR3 1333/1600 DIMM sockets
Maximum up to 16GB DDR3 memory
Supports DDR3 1066/1333 memory
Onboard Multi-I/O
Parallel Port: one 26-pin 2.54-pitch box-header, SPP/EPP/ECP supported
Serial Port: one for RS-232/422/485 with 10-pin, 2.54-pitch box-header (COM1) and one port for
RS-232 with 10-pin, 2.54-pitch box-header (COM2)
Floppy controller: one 34-pin, 2.54-pitch box-header supports two drives (1.44MB for each)
VGA Controller
Intel® Arrandale integrated a Graphic processing unit processor which goes with Q77 chipset with
VGA, DisplayPort (co-lay with VGA) and DVI
Memory Size - Intel
®
DVMT 5.0 supported; preallocated memory for frame buffer option as OS
option:
1. Windows XP:
* For Total System Memory < 1GB,
Graphics sharing memory = 128 MB Maximum;
* For 1 GB to 1.5 GB Total System Memory,
Graphics sharing memory = 512 MB Maximum;
* For 1.5 GB to 2 GB Total System Memory,
Graphics sharing memory = 768 MB Maximum;
* For 2 GB and Above Total System Memory,
Graphics sharing memory = 1GB Maximum.
2. Windows Vista:
* Graphics sharing memory max to 0.5* (OS Ram Size – 512)
Resolution -- Analog output -- the analog port utilizes an integrated 400MHz 24-bit RAMDAC that
can directly drive a standard progressive scan analog monitor up to a resolution of 2048x1536
pixels with 32-bit color at 75 Hz
Analog Output Interface -- CRT from DAC output via 15-pin D-Sub connector on the edge; CRT
always ON supported
